Wyoming Update and Outlook


The state’s seasonally adjusted unemployment rate was 5.8% in December 2011, unchanged from a month earlier. Wyoming’s jobless rate has stayed between 5.7% and 5.9% since June 2011. However, it was considerably lower than its December 2010 level of 6.4% and significantly below the current U.S. rate of 8.5%.

Total nonfarm employment (measured by place of work) rose from 282,600 in December 2010 to 289,000 in December 2011, an increase of 6,400 jobs (2.3%).
